    My sister is pregnant right now and the doc told her the typical amount a woman should increase her calories by is only 200-250, none of that "eating for 2 stuff" lol. My sister gained like 12lbs in 3wks so he told her to slow it down. She's tiny and needed to gain weight anyways, but I was surprised to hear the calorie increase is that low
